I doubt they have cut it back intentionally, there is actually so little tobacco in a stick cost-wise they would save little money by cutting it back. About 1/3 of what you have in your cig is actually old cigs returned, chopped up, and recycled. I doubt there is $.03 of tobacco in each one.

It is quite possible you got an under filled pack, the biggest clue to me would be the smoking them faster. Ever since they added the chemical to make them go out if left unattended too long, they seem to smoke a lot slower. If they were looser and had more airflow I suspect it would smoke much faster like you feel. They probably won't do anything about it, but that sucks nonetheless.
